Python的多线程机制一直是开发者的困惑点:明明开启了多线程,处理CPU密集型任务时,性能却没有提升,甚至比单线程更慢。这背后的核心原因,就是Python的全局解释器锁(GIL),它也是Python面试中高频考察的难点,同时也是技术社区常年讨论的热门话题。
Python 3.14 正式引入了一个新的机制叫作 Tail Call Interpreter(Made by Ken Jin),这无疑又是一个奠定未来基础的重大工作 对于这样的代码我们最终的汇编会是什么样的呢?可能大家第一反应是先 cmp 然后 je ,不等式秒了,我们编译一个版本来看看 我们能看到整体如 ...
"编程不应该有语言的界限,代码的世界应该是包容的、开放的。" 作为一名中国程序员,我深知编程语言的英文门槛阻碍了许多人学习编程的热情。当我看到孩子们、老人们或非英语背景的人们因为语言障碍而放弃学习编程时,我感到非常遗憾。 中文Python解释器 ...
Python编程语言迎来了新的里程碑——Python 3.13正式发布。这个版本带来了一系列激动人心的新特性和性能改进,为开发者提供了更强大的工具和更高效的编程体验。 去除全局解释器锁(GIL) Python 3.13最引人注目的变化之一是实验性地去除了全局解释器锁(Global Interpreter ...
王树义。大学教师,终身学习者。稍微懂一点儿写作、演讲、Python和机器学习。欢迎关注我的公众号“玉树芝兰”(nkwangshuyi)。 Llama 3 的发布,真可谓一石激起千层浪。前两天,许多人还对「闭源模型能力普遍大于开源模型」的论断表示赞同。但是,最新的 LLM ...
Open Interpreter 可以总结 pdf 长文、还能将 word 文件转换成 pdf 文件等。 今年 7 月,OpenAI 开放了一个强大的插件 ——Code Interpreter(代码解释器),它可以根据用户的自然语言需求,生成并执行代码解决方案,最终完成分析数据、创建图表、编辑文件等任务。
目前ChatGPT已经逐渐对Plus用户开放了Code Interpreter功能,该插件可以支持用户上传文档进行数据分析,支持用用户上传代码进行代码运行,以及debug,它 是一个可以解析和执行代码的功能。它能够解析多种编程语言的代码,包括 Python、JavaScript、Java、C++ 等。
王树义。大学教师,终身学习者。稍微懂一点儿写作、演讲、Python和机器学习。欢迎关注我的公众号“玉树芝兰”(nkwangshuyi)。 Matrix 是少数派的写作社区,我们主张分享真实的产品体验,有实用价值的经验与思考。我们会不定期挑选 Matrix 最优质的文章,展示 ...
该repository包含基于Python/Matlab的绘制opensees模型及模态的相关代码。 用户需要查看的唯一文件是“runme.py”,所有其他文件都 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果